Managed to pick-up this Tacoma track photo (ca. 1905-08) for well under $100. Never thought I'd acquire an Ernie Tanner (1889-1956) image, as they are very few, and this is a previously unknown photo. Professed to be "the greatest athlete ever produced in the state of Washington" in his 1956 obituary, he was a phenomenal four sport/four year athlete in high school, who led tiny Whitworth College to an upset victory over the University of Oregon on the gridiron in 1908 (16-10). He was also an influential African American labor leader on the Tacoma waterfront for decades.
